Output 5d29f3cee6d153134fa68e71b5b50b52fa5c368aabd06e9d7306c1ff0bbfe8ed:0

value
28273810
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59acebca18c868171d521a7ee46390dfdbc33da6 OP_EQUAL
address
MG5KXGXLgtA1wbE1QNvDy3uB3xbZeYG16S
transaction
5d29f3cee6d153134fa68e71b5b50b52fa5c368aabd06e9d7306c1ff0bbfe8ed
spent
true